Output e843bbd85cd087c9c4e88c6056087dd99ffd94d5df88b3a381ea849a0115e003:7

value
1015812764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3553b84c54cc6d4cdf496a35ee0d48fca043e7a OP_EQUAL
address
MRhz6tqvYTMbXe46W9NiPWRSY4kgWb1Cqy
transaction
e843bbd85cd087c9c4e88c6056087dd99ffd94d5df88b3a381ea849a0115e003
spent
true